如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

跨账户私有API网关:安全与便捷的完美结合

跨账户私有API网关:安全与便捷的完美结合

在云计算时代,企业对数据安全和访问控制的需求日益增长。跨账户私有API网关Private API Gateway Cross Account)作为一种新兴的技术解决方案,正在成为企业实现安全、便捷的API管理的首选工具。本文将详细介绍跨账户私有API网关的概念、工作原理、应用场景以及其带来的优势。

什么是跨账户私有API网关?

跨账户私有API网关是一种允许不同AWS账户之间安全共享API的服务。传统的API网关通常在一个账户内管理所有API,而跨账户私有API网关则允许一个账户中的API被其他账户安全访问,同时保持对API的控制和安全性。

工作原理

  1. 资源共享:通过AWS的资源共享机制(Resource Access Manager, RAM),一个账户可以将API网关的资源共享给其他账户。

  2. 访问控制:使用IAM角色和策略,确保只有授权的账户和用户可以访问共享的API。

  3. 私有链接:利用AWS PrivateLink,确保API调用在AWS网络内部进行,避免通过公共互联网传输数据,提高安全性。

  4. 日志和监控:通过CloudWatch和X-Ray等服务,提供详细的日志和监控,帮助管理和审计API的使用情况。

应用场景

  1. 企业间合作:不同企业或组织之间需要共享API资源时,跨账户私有API网关可以确保数据安全和访问控制。

  2. 多环境管理:在开发、测试和生产环境中,API可以被不同账户访问,简化环境管理和资源共享。

  3. 微服务架构:在微服务架构中,服务间通信可以通过跨账户私有API网关实现,确保服务的独立性和安全性。

  4. 第三方集成:当企业需要与第三方服务提供商集成时,可以通过跨账户私有API网关安全地共享API,保护企业数据。

优势

  • 安全性:通过私有链接和严格的访问控制,确保API调用的安全性,防止数据泄露。

  • 便捷性:简化了跨账户API的管理和共享,减少了配置复杂性。

  • 成本效益:共享API资源可以减少重复构建和维护API的成本。

  • 可扩展性:随着业务增长,跨账户私有API网关可以轻松扩展,支持更多的账户和API。

  • 合规性:帮助企业满足各种数据保护和隐私法规的要求,如GDPR、CCPA等。

实施注意事项

在实施跨账户私有API网关时,需要注意以下几点:

  • 权限管理:确保每个账户的权限设置合理,避免过度授权。

  • 网络配置:正确配置VPC和私有链接,确保网络隔离和安全。

  • 监控和审计:定期审查日志和监控数据,确保API的使用符合预期。

  • 成本管理:监控API调用的成本,避免意外费用。

结论

跨账户私有API网关为企业提供了一种安全、便捷的API管理方式,适用于各种复杂的业务场景。它不仅提高了API的安全性和可管理性,还促进了企业间的合作和资源共享。在云计算的未来,跨账户私有API网关无疑将成为企业IT架构中的重要组成部分,帮助企业在安全与便捷之间找到平衡点。

通过本文的介绍,希望读者能够对跨账户私有API网关有更深入的了解,并在实际应用中发挥其最大价值。